The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 54418 zip code is $87292. This is 8.30% greater than the national average. This income places 11.5%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$29443. Education
In the 54418 zip code, 92%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 14.3%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 54418 zip, there are an estimated 536 people in the labor force, of which, 526 are employed, and 10 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 27.3 minutes. Of the total people that work, 17 worked from home and 512 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 42.2. Housing
The median home value for the 54418 zip code is 145700. There is an estimated 346 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$542 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$738.
